Brazil releases Covid-19 vaccines and starts vaccination plan

di Bianca Oliveira

SAN PAOLO DEL BRASILE – Brazil’s Anvisa health regulator, responsible for the release of immunizers and medicines in Brazil, approved the emergency use of Sinovac coronavirus vaccine, known as CoronaVac, produced in partnership with Butantan Institute, and the vaccine from the University of Oxford / AstraZeneca, which will be produced locally by Fiocruz. With the green light, Brazil begins its national vaccination plan, which prioritizes, in the first stage, healthcare workers who are at the front line of the fight against the pandemic, elderly people over 60 years old and the indigenous population. Anvisa was the only agency in the world to analyze 2 emergency protocols simultaneously within a period of 9 days. The analysis process for emergency use was adopted for the first time in the country due to the health crisis. Soon after the release by the health regulator, the first Brazilian was inoculated at Hospital das Clínicas, in the city of São Paulo, with the vaccine requested by the Butantan Institute. Mônica Calazans, 54-years-old nurse and is within the high-risk groups. The vaccination was monitored by the state governor, João Doria. “Today is the” V “day. Vaccine Day, Victory Day, Truth (Verdade) Day, Life (Vida) Day. Today is the day of those who value and fight for life”, says Doria. In a press conference, the Minister of Health, Eduardo Pazuello, stated that the vaccination plan will be coordinated by the Ministry of Health, which will start this Monday (18th) the distribution of vaccines to all states in an equal and simultaneous way. “The distribution of vaccines will start on Monday, at 7 am. We plan for Wednesday, at 10 am, the start of the National Immunization Plan, at the same time, in all states. This time is the minimum logistics for the states ”, says Pazuello. Brazil has 6 million doses of CoronaVac in national territory for immediate use and is awaiting clearance from the government of India to import 2 million doses from Covishield.
